Understanding the 45-Foot Shipping Container

A 45 foot long containers-foot shipping container, likewise called a 45-foot high cube container, is a standardized steel box developed to transport goods across fars away. It determines 45 feet in length, 8 feet in width, and 9 feet 6 inches in height. This size is somewhat bigger than the more typical 40-foot container, providing extra capacity for cargo.

Dimensions and Specifications

  • Length: 45 feet (13.72 meters)
  • Width: 8 feet (2.44 meters)
  • Height: 9 feet 6 inches (2.90 meters)
  • Internal Volume: Approximately 3,060 cubic feet (86.6 cubic meters)
  • Tare Weight: Approximately 8,000 pounds (3,628 kilograms)
  • Maximum Gross Weight: Approximately 67,200 pounds (30,480 kilograms)

Key Benefits of 45-Foot Shipping Containers

  1. Increased Cargo Capacity: The additional 5 feet in length provides more space for cargo, making it ideal for bigger deliveries. This can lower the variety of containers required for a given volume of items, lowering transport costs.

  2. Cost Efficiency: Despite the bigger size, the cost per cubic foot of cargo is often lower compared to smaller containers. This makes 45-foot containers a cost-effective option for bulk deliveries.

  3. Flexibility: These containers can be utilized for a wide variety of goods, from bulk commodities to delicate and oversized products. They are appropriate for both maritime and overland transportation, making them a versatile choice for various logistics requires.

  4. Improved Load Distribution: The extra length enables much better load circulation, which can enhance the stability and safety of the cargo during transit.

  5. Enhanced Security: Like other shipping containers, 45-foot containers are equipped with robust locking mechanisms and can be sealed for included security. This helps safeguard the cargo from theft and damage.

Challenges and Considerations

While 45-foot shipping containers provide many benefits, there are likewise some challenges to think about:

  1. Port and Infrastructure Constraints: Not all ports and logistics facilities are equipped to deal with 45-foot containers. Shippers need to guarantee that their location has the required facilities to accommodate these bigger containers.

  2. Transportation Regulations: Some nations and areas have particular policies concerning the transportation of large containers. Shippers ought to know these regulations to avoid delays and additional expenses.

  3. Packing and Unloading: The bigger size can make packing and discharging more complex, requiring specific equipment and knowledgeable labor.

  4. Cost: While the cost per cubic foot is typically lower, the total cost of a 45-foot container can be higher than that of a smaller sized container. Shippers need to weigh the benefits against the expenses to figure out the most cost-efficient choice.
